Maharashtra DGP Rashmi Shukla Transferred Ahead Of Assembly Elections

The Election Commission of India has directed the immediate transfer of Rashmi Shukla, the Director General of Police (DGP) for Maharashtra. It has also instructed the Maharashtra Chief Secretary to delegate her responsibilities to the next senior-most officer in the Indian Police Service (IPS) cadre.

Sources indicate that the Chief Secretary must present a panel of three potential candidates for the new DGP position by 1 PM on 5 November 2024.

This decision comes in light of the ECI’s commitment to ensuring free and fair elections in the state.

Chief Election Commissioner Rajiv Kumar had previously emphasized the importance of impartiality among officials during review meetings leading up to the assembly elections. He urged them to maintain a non-partisan image while carrying out their duties.

Maharashtra will likely hold elections for its 288 assembly seats on 20 November, and officials will announce the results on 23 November.

Earlier on 15 October, the ECI asserted, “The total number of voters in Maharashtra is about 9.63 crore in total.”

In a related note, the ECI recently accepted the Jharkhand government’s proposal to appoint the senior-most IAS officer from the 1988 batch as the Chief Secretary of Jharkhand.

The Commission had also approved a five-month extension for former Chief Secretary Lalbiaktluanga Khiangte.

Last month, Ajay Kumar Singh, the senior-most IPS officer in the Jharkhand cadre, was appointed as the new DGP following the ECI’s directive to replace acting DGP Anurag Gupta.

The Commission removed Gupta due to concerns about his conduct in previous elections, emphasizing its commitment to maintaining integrity and accountability in the electoral process.
